Traditional Fishing Techniques
From simple traps and hand-gathering methods to more elaborate procedures involving nets and boats, the diversity in traditional fishing techniques is astounding. For example, the use of spears, practiced by various indigenous groups, demonstrates a keen understanding of aquatic ecosystems and fish behavior. Similarly, the development of nets, woven from plant fibers and later from synthetic materials, showcases the evolution of both technology and craftsmanship.
Fishing Cultures Around the World
Fishing holds cultural significance across the globe, reflected in varied practices and rituals. In Japan, traditional Ukai fishing employs trained cormorants to catch fish, a method rich in history and ceremony. Meanwhile, fly fishing in North America's rivers is revered not only as a technique but as a meditative art form.
